CVE-2021-39352
Last modified
CVE-2021-39352 is a high-severity vulnerability rated 7.2/10 on the CVSS scale. The Catch Themes Demo Import WordPress plugin is vulnerable to arbitrary file uploads via the import functionality found in the ~/inc/CatchThemesDemoImport.php file, in versions up to and including 1.7, due to insufficient file type validation. This makes it possible for an attacker with administrative privileges to upload malicious files that can be used to achieve remote code execution.. EPSS estimates a 56.65%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
